Assigning Groups to Project Roles

After the groups have been created, assign each group to the corresponding project role and any additional project roles that may be required. The project roles, which are defined in the related process applications, give the group members privileges to that project. For additional details on how to assign a group to a role, see the SBM Application Administrator Guide.

Important: The RLC - Approvers role is required to initiate the deployment into environments that require approval. Other roles do not include approval privileges.

Setting Privileges Not Set in Snapshots

The following tables are generated when the Release Package snapshot is promoted:

Because these tables are generated after the first time the Release Package process app is promoted, they cannot be given privileges through roles. Therefore, the privileges must be set for your groups (or users, if you give user-level privileges) after you have generated the view and promoted the Release Package process app the second time.

Group Role for Projects Table Privileges
RLC Administrators
  • Administrator for all Release Control projects

Table privileges for the following views:

  • RLC Deployment Log
  • RLC DU Environment
  • RLC DU Execution Log
Minimum privileges:
  • View
  • Run Guest-Level reports
  • Modify Guest-Level reports

RLC Package Creators

  • Package Creator for Release Packages projects
  • Package Creator for Deployment Path projects
  • Package Creator for Environment Schedule projects
  • Package Creator for Path Elements project

Table privileges for the following views:

  • RLC Deployment Log
  • RLC DU Environment
  • RLC DU Execution Log
Minimum privileges:
  • View
  • Run Guest-Level reports
Important: DO NOT give Delete report privileges!
RLC Release Engineers
  • Release Engineer for all RLC projects
  • User for Sample Request projects (if using)

Table privileges for the following views:

  • RLC Deployment Log
  • RLC DU Environment
  • RLC DU Execution Log
Minimum privileges:
  • View
  • Run Guest-Level reports
Important: DO NOT give Delete report privileges!
RLC Release Managers
  • Release Manager for all RLC projects

Table privileges for the following views:

  • RLC Deployment Log
  • RLC DU Environment
  • RLC DU Execution Log
Minimum privileges:
  • View
  • Run Guest-Level reports
Important: DO NOT give Delete report privileges!
RLC Users
  • User for all RLC projects

Table privileges for the following views:

  • RLC Deployment Log
  • RLC DU Environment
  • RLC DU Execution Log
Minimum privileges:
  • View
  • Run Guest-Level reports
Important: DO NOT give Delete report privileges!
RLC Approvers
  • Release Approver for Approvals projects
  • Release Approver for Release Data projects
None required, as all necessary privileges will be assigned through the role
